FARGO (AP) — A North Dakota man has been sentenced to more than nine years in prison on federal weapons charges.
Anthony Hayes Jr., of Hankinson, pleaded guilty in August to possession of firearms and ammunition by a convicted felon and possession of an unregistered firearm.
Authorities said the 30-year-old Hayes possessed four firearms and assorted ammunition. One of the weapons was stolen, along with a silencer.
Hayes previous was convicted of assault in Anoka County, Minn., in July 2006.
